    The Serukelle station serves as a base for ecological research in dry zone habitats, with a focus on:

    • Longitudinal studies on forest succession and climate resilience

    • Restoration of degraded landscapes using native species

    • Monitoring avian biodiversity along migratory routes

    • Promoting reforestation through community-led agroforestry models
